The key differences between Pearson Edexcel International GCSE (91) English Language A and B are that Specification B uses unseen texts and is assessed through one, three-hour examination, with no optional coursework route, whereas Specification A has either 2 exams or 1 exam and coursework.
GCSEs, known as General Certificate of Secondary Education, are mandatory exams taken in the UK when a student finishes high school. Outside of the UK, IGCSEs (International General Certificate of Secondary Education) provide the exact same level of qualification as GCSEs but are available worldwide.

It is intended for pupils whose first language is English. It assesses pupils on their ability to communicate clearly, accurately and with style, and to read critically and with insight. All candidates sit a reading exam.
The International General Certificate of Secondary Education (IGCSE) is an English language based secondary qualification similar to the GCSE and is recognised in the United Kingdom as being equivalent to the GCSE for the purposes of recognising prior attainment.
